2010 Officers
|
President
David Doyle

|
David bought his first rental property, a triplex, after getting out of the Navy in 1971. He moved to Kentucky in the mid 70’s where he had an automotive business and a motorsports production company. After moving to Jacksonville in 1992, he again got back into rental housing business. Putting a down payment on a few rental duplexes and letting others pay off the note looked like a good retirement plan. He has been a participant the last five years on the MrLandLord.com annual landlord conference cruise and has been recognized as one of the top contributors to the MrLandLord.com Q&A discussion board. Today he tends to his rentals, buys and sells a few properties, and moderates the JaxREIA Landlord Networking Group. |

Vice President
Curtis Newberg

|
I have been investing in real estate since the late 1980’s. My objective when I started was to retire when I was 55. Well I did retire when I was 55 and it was because of my real estate. My wife, Jaudon, retired from her job as well. We still manage our own properties. I will do other deals during the year like owner financing, lend hard money or buy a rehab, but my favorite has been lot developing. I still own the first investment property that I bought. It makes me $2000 a month with a little management. So you could say I am a long term buy and hold; free and clear investor. JaxREIA has made this all possible for me, so I love to give back by helping other investors.

Gregg Cohen, CEO of Progress Home Buyers, LLC, began his real estate investing career at the ripe-old age of 23. Even though he had no previous real estate experience and little money to start, Gregg has since purchased over 100 properties and has built one of Jacksonville’s biggest home buying companies. Currently Progress Home Buyers is buying 1-2 houses each week.
Gregg has quickly established himself as a respected expert in the fields of real estate marketing and business systems and has been invited to speak nationally with his mentor, Than Merrill from A&E’s “Flip This House.” Locally, Gregg also teaches Quick Start and Master’s Series classes for JaxREIA and has been invited to speak to local business organizations at Jacksonville University and the University of North Florida. He and his team received the “2008 Inspiration Award” from JaxREIA and have been featured in publications such as The Florida Times-Union and Investor Insights. He currently serves on the Board of Directors for JaxREIA.
